On God's Rocky Shore by Cahalen West & Eli West

Cahalen West & Eli West are a couple of young guys from Seattle in the USA and they made a great album called The Holy Coming of the Storm.  On God's Rocky Shore is the second track on the album and, as it contains the words of the title in the chorus, I suppose it is the title track.  The whole album is exceptional, a quiet and considered collection of quality tunes and songs, but I think On God's Rocky Shore  is excellent.

The song is under 3 minutes but is a sublime mix of soulful vocal harmonies and old-timey instrumentation [including banjo clicks].  The resulting combination of a sparce and skilled musical setting and biblical and folky lyrics easily exceeds the components.  The song bounces along on waves of "proper" musicianship and playing, each part both balanced and complimented by all the others.

It's old fashioned music, it's rural music, it's important music.  It is a recent favourite but one due to last. 
It is beauty and truth.
